Ossett Southdale Church of England Voluntary Controlled Junior School Overview
Ossett Southdale Church of England Voluntary Controlled Junior School is a junior school located in Ossett and reports to the local authority of Wakefield.
Ossett Southdale Church of England Voluntary Controlled Junior School is a mixed gender school that caters to students aged from 7 to 11 years old and it has a Church of England religious affiliation
Currently the school is undersubscribed as it has an official capacity of 360 students but currently only enrols 337 pupils across all class years. This can generally mean that all applications to this school stand a much stronger chance of being accepted.
Ossett Southdale Church of England Voluntary Controlled Junior School students range across many different ethnicities with White British being the predominant ethnicity, accounting for 92.9% of all current students. English as a 1st language accounts for 1.2% of students at the school.
14.8% of all students at the school qualify for free school meals and 0% of Ossett Southdale Church of England Voluntary Controlled Junior School pupils are classed as SEN students who have a range of special educational needs.
